# neq
Returns true if the first argument is not equal to the second argument.
## Parameters
* a (`integer`, `float`, `double`, `string`, `boolean`) - The first value to compare.
* b (`integer`, `float`, `double`, `string`, `boolean`) - The second value to compare.
## Return
(`boolean`) - True if the first argument is not equal to the second argument.
## Exceptions
* `EvaluationException` - If there was an error while evaluating one or more parameters.
* `TypeException` - If one or more parameters are not of the expected type.
## Instruction Example
```json
{
"type": "neq",
"_": {
"a": "foo",
"b": "foo"
}
}
```
